Author: norman
Date: Tue Feb 23 07:28:21 2010
New Revision: 915221

URL: http://svn.apache.org/viewvc?rev=915221&view=rev
Log:
Fix login on second attempt (JAMES-974)

Modified:
    
james/server/trunk/remotemanager/src/main/java/org/apache/james/remotemanager/core/AuthorizationHandler.java

Modified: 
james/server/trunk/remotemanager/src/main/java/org/apache/james/remotemanager/core/AuthorizationHandler.java
URL: 
http://svn.apache.org/viewvc/james/server/trunk/remotemanager/src/main/java/org/apache/james/remotemanager/core/AuthorizationHandler.java?rev=915221&r1=915220&r2=915221&view=diff
==============================================================================
--- 
james/server/trunk/remotemanager/src/main/java/org/apache/james/remotemanager/core/AuthorizationHandler.java
 (original)
+++ 
james/server/trunk/remotemanager/src/main/java/org/apache/james/remotemanager/core/AuthorizationHandler.java
 Tue Feb 23 07:28:21 2010
@@ -74,6 +74,10 @@
                         final String message = "Login failed for " + username;
                         session.writeResponse(new 
RemoteManagerResponse(message));
                         session.writeResponse(new RemoteManagerResponse("Login 
id:"));
+
+                        // we need to handle the next line as login again
+                        session.getState().put(AUTHORIZATION_STATE, 
LOGIN_SUPPLIED);
+
                     } else {
                         StringBuilder messageBuffer = new 
StringBuilder(64).append("Welcome ").append(username).append(". HELP for a list 
of commands");
                         session.writeResponse(new 
RemoteManagerResponse(messageBuffer.toString()));



---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to